Maven - 如何从远程pom.xml中提取/下载依赖项

时间:2016-04-22 21:36:39

标签: java xml maven remote-server

我正在为一个java项目组建一个{ "email": "jane.doe@email.com", "name": "Jane Doe", "roleName": "RoleOne", "recipientId": "1", "clientUserId": "1001", "tabs": { "textTabs": [ { "tabLabel": "ApplicantAddress", "value": "221 Main St. Suite 1000 San Francisco, CA 94105" }, { "tabLabel": "ApplicantSSN", "value": "12-345-6789" } ] } } 。这个java项目有一些java代码,它依赖于私有远程存储库中存在的许多其他库。

在我的pom.xml

pom.xml

请注意,工件是<dependency> <groupId>com.mycom</groupId> <artifactId>my-id</artifactId> <type>pom</type> <version>9.1.00-SNAPSHOT</version> </dependency> 。此POM包含对工件ID pom的所有依赖项的引用。

我面临的问题是:

  1. 如果我将my-id更改为<type>,则它不起作用,因为实际文件不是单个jar,而是一个引用所有依赖项的POM文件。
  2. 已下载远程POM,但maven不会下载并安装远程POM中引用的所有相关jar库。
  3. 如何实现最终目标:让maven从远程仓库获取最新的POM文件,然后作为依赖项下载此远程.jar中列出的所有jar文件?这甚至可能吗?

0 个答案:

没有答案